The Panthers' $1.2M commitment to Dan Chisena represents a slight overpay for what amounts to a roster bubble player with minimal NFL production. While the dollar figure itself is modest in NFL terms, Chisena's unproven performance tier makes even this relatively small investment questionable value — you're essentially paying starter-adjacent money for a player who hasn't demonstrated he belongs beyond special teams. The former track star turned wide receiver has shown flashes of athleticism since converting from Minnesota's sprint team, but his route-running remains raw and his hands inconsistent, hallmarks of a developmental project rather than someone ready to contribute meaningfully. The short-term nature of the deal does provide Carolina with an easy exit ramp, but they're still allocating precious salary cap space to a player who profiles more as a practice squad candidate than a legitimate NFL receiver. This D-grade CVI reflects the fundamental mismatch between compensation and proven production — even modest overpays add up in a league where every dollar matters, and the Panthers would have been better served finding similar upside at minimum wage or investing this money in a more established contributor.
